Overview of Blackstone Secured Lending Fund’s business
Blackstone Secured Lending Fund (BXSL) is a specialty finance company operating as a non-diversified, externally managed, closed-end investment company, regulated as a BDC. It aims to generate current income and long-term capital appreciation by investing in the debt of private U.S. companies, primarily in originated loans and other securities, with a focus on first lien senior secured and unitranche loans. As of September 30, 2025, a significant portion of its investments were in first lien senior secured debt and floating rate debt investments, largely comprised of sponsor-backed companies.

Ownership
Blackstone Secured Lending Fund's ownership is a mix of institutional, retail, and individual investors. Institutional investors hold approximately 8.33% to 34.38% of the company's stock, while retail investors hold a significant portion, around 65.51% to 89.73%. Insiders own a very small percentage. Major institutional owners include Morgan Stanley, Bank Of America Corp /de/, and Nomura Asset Management Co Ltd. Stephen A. Schwarzman owns the most shares among individual investors.
